Biography

"Miguel A. Lagunas was born in Madrid in 1951. He is Telecommunications Engineer (UPM, Madrid 1973) and holds a Ph D. in Communications (UPB, Barcelona 1976), teaching courses in Network Systems, Circuit Analysis, Stochastic Processes, Signal Processing, Signal Processing for Communications, Array processing, Satellite Communications, Spectral Estimation, Acoustics, Electroacoustics and Sonar. He has been teaching assistant (1973-76), adjunt (1976-78), associate (1978-82), advisor through Fullbrigh grant (University of Colorado, L.J.Griffiths, 1981-1982), and he is full professor since 1983. He has published more than 42 technical papers on IEEE Communications, IEEE Acoustic Speech and Signal Processing, JASA and Signal Processing. He has made as well 39 invited presentations in universities, communications industry and international conferences, and has presented more than 134 papers on international conferences. He has been prime and participant in 19 projects of the Spanish National Plan of Research and in 18 from the European Union and the European Space Agency projects. He was Vice-president for research of UPC (1986-89), Vice-secretary General of the Spanish National Plan of Research (1994-96), Manager of the National Plan on Information Technology and Communications (1993-94), Senior IEEE (1991) and IEEE Fellow (1997), as well as Member at large of Eurasip since 1990. He was elected Member of the Engineering Academy of Spain in 1998, holding awards from UPC, Generalitat and Chamber of Commerce for technical merits (1990 and 1991 respectively)."
